
Originally from Colorado, Mrs. Palmore has been a member of St. Bride Parish since 1974. She was on the faculty of St. Bride School for 26 years, 7 of those years as principal. Mrs. Palmore holds a Bachelors of Arts Degree in English and History from the University of Colorado and a Masters Degree in Education from Loyola University in the areas of Leadership, Human Resources, Development, and Curriculum. She holds Administration Certification from the State of Illinois. She is also a Certified Catechist for the Archdiocese of Chicago.
Mrs. Palmore is involved in the planning, organization, supervision, and business management of all parish programs including the After School Program, Thursday Morning Connections Food Pantry, Catholic Schools Scholarship Program, Faith Sharing Groups, parish outreach, catechesis and sacramental programs.
Mrs. Palmore is the site supervisor for the Catholic Theological Union students who choose St. Bride Parish for their Ministry Practicum.
